    At the end, you mentioned wondering about cleaning the brush…. I’ve copied other people who I’ve seen cleaning smaller blending brushes with inks - they grab a roll of kitchen towel and just rub the brush up and down the paper roll until the colour stops coming off. Then when the outside of the roll gets too dirty, they just tear off that outside sheet (it’s easier that way than trying to rub the brush off on a loose sheet of kitchen towel). I also guess it depends if you want to use other colours, I mean if it’s only going to be used for “grungy” colours to age the edges, it might not need cleaning at all. 😊
